What's in the feed now

Tax year 2023 — spent $12,770 more than it took in. Revenue $100,689 · expenses $113,459 · reserve months 18.1
Tax year 2022 — spent $10,894 more than it took in. Revenue $77,180 · expenses $88,074 · reserve months 25.0
Tax year 2021 — spent $14,502 more than it took in. Revenue $54,353 · expenses $68,855 · reserve months 30.8
Tax year 2020 — spent $63,020 more than it took in. Revenue $40,946 · expenses $103,966 · reserve months 22.1
Tax year 2019 — spent $42,394 more than it took in. Revenue $79,502 · expenses $121,896 · reserve months 25.0
Tax year 2018 — spent $16,335 more than it took in. Revenue $116,989 · expenses $133,324 · reserve months 26.7
Tax year 2017 — spent $69,579 more than it took in. Revenue $92,172 · expenses $161,751 · reserve months 23.2
Tax year 2016 — spent $74,548 more than it took in. Revenue $120,238 · expenses $194,786 · reserve months 23.6
Tax year 2015 — took in $17,147 more than it spent. Revenue $222,044 · expenses $204,897 · reserve months 24.8
Tax year 2014 — took in $1,645 more than it spent. Revenue $217,757 · expenses $216,112 · reserve months 17.3
Tax year 2013 — took in $1,229,959 more than it spent. Revenue $1,467,446 · expenses $237,487 · reserve months 20.0
Tax year 2012 — spent $52,478 more than it took in. Revenue $201,196 · expenses $253,674 · reserve months 24.7
Tax year 2011 — took in $136,407 more than it spent. Revenue $267,507 · expenses $131,100 · reserve months 39.8
